Yoga on the Run
One of the great things about yoga is that each pose counteracts all of the stresses and abuse you put your body through—whether it’s hunching over a computer keyboard for nine hours or pounding the pavement for fifteen miles. Simply adding a few poses to your post-run routine or taking one or two weekly yoga classes will help increase flexibility, prevent injuries (by strengthening the muscles around your joints to improve stability), speed recovery, and even improve speed through increased range of motion.
